Output 6c04a34cca67b65a8f3adf719829aeaa2c35e929931f2e0ec7d5ffebf4c8fc01:2

value
161637659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72fbd7deecdecc01608caf5b9843fcfeb36706cc OP_EQUAL
address
3CAzenefFSo27QrG4DpwsUfL2mMU3iaZHt
transaction
6c04a34cca67b65a8f3adf719829aeaa2c35e929931f2e0ec7d5ffebf4c8fc01
spent
true